Question
the n = 1 energy level contains ________ p orbitals, while all other energy levels contain ______ p orbitals. 2, 6 0, 3 6, 2 3, 3 0, 4
In quantum mechanics, for a given principal quantum number \(n\), the angular - momentum quantum number \(l\) can take values from \(0\) to \(n - 1\). For \(p\) orbitals, \(l = 1\). When \(n=1\), \(l\) can only be \(0\) (s - orbital), so there are \(0\) \(p\) orbitals. For \(n\geq2\), when \(l = 1\) (p - orbital), the magnetic quantum number \(m_l\) can take values \(-l,-l + 1,\cdots,l\). When \(l = 1\), \(m_l=- 1,0,1\), so there are \(3\) \(p\) orbitals.
